Management Meeting Minutes — Reseller Programme

Present: Dena Forsgate, Ollie Rennick, Priya Calloway.

Quick recap: the Fernlight reseller programme is tracking ahead of plan — 14 partners signed versus the 10 we'd hoped for. Margins are a bit thinner than modelled, mostly down to the tiered discount we offered early joiners. Ollie will tighten the discount bands before the next intake. Where we want to take the programme next is covered in the note below.

board note of yahip-tadug: Headcount on the Zorath team goes from 9 to 100 by the end of April. Gross margin on Zorath came in at 10 percent against a plan of 20 percent.

## Deploying the Gatewick Proctor Queue

Deploys are pretty painless: push to main, wait for the pipeline, then watch the queue drain dashboard for five minutes. If candidates pile up mid-exam, roll back first and ask questions later — the queue replays safely. Everything the workers care about lives in one config block, shown here for reference.

settings of bafof-yagef:
JOROX_PIN=8740
JOROX_TENANT=pelox
JOROX_METRICS_HOST=metrics.jorox.qorvelworks.internal
JOROX_SEAL=seal_c78f63c1
JOROX_STANDBY_TEAM=norax

## 2.8.0 — Changed defaults

The Ovenlark order-cutoff rule has changed. Same-day bakery orders now close at the store-local cutoff instead of a global timestamp, and late submissions are rejected server-side rather than queued. Client-side checks are advisory only; enforcement moved to the order gateway. Audit relevance: rejected orders are logged with reason codes. The gateway ships with these defaults.

settings of tagef-bawif:
DRUIX_HOST=druix.zemvarlabs.internal
DRUIX_PORT=8000